4. Setup & Installation

Follow these steps to properly install your Orbit Quarter-Circle Shrub Spray Sprinkler:

  1. Prepare the Riser: Ensure you have a 1/2-inch FNPT (Female National Pipe Thread) riser ready for connection. The riser should be securely installed in the desired watering location.
  2. Thread Connection: Carefully thread the sprinkler head onto the 1/2-inch FNPT riser. Hand-tighten the connection to prevent leaks. Do not overtighten, as this can damage the threads.
  3. Positioning: Orient the sprinkler head so that the quarter-circle spray pattern covers the intended area. The fixed spray pattern is designed to water a 90-degree arc.
  4. Initial Water Test: Turn on the water supply to the sprinkler system. Check for any leaks at the connection point. If leaks occur, gently tighten the sprinkler head further.

5. Operating Instructions

The Orbit Quarter-Circle Shrub Spray Sprinkler is designed for straightforward operation. Once installed, you can adjust the water flow and distance to suit your specific watering needs.

Adjusting Flow and Distance:

  1. Locate Adjustment Screw: Identify the small screw located on the top of the brass nozzle.
  2. Decrease Flow/Distance: Turn the screw clockwise using a flathead screwdriver to reduce the water flow and spray distance.
  3. Increase Flow/Distance: Turn the screw counter-clockwise to increase the water flow and spray distance.
  4. Observe Spray Pattern: Make small adjustments and observe the spray pattern to achieve the desired coverage.

Note: The sprinkler delivers a fixed quarter-circle spray pattern. Adjustments primarily affect the distance and volume of water, not the arc of the spray.

6. Maintenance

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ance and extends the life of your sprinkler head.

Cleaning the Filter:

The sprinkler head includes a clog-preventing filter. If you notice reduced performance or an irregular spray pattern, the filter may need cleaning.

  1. Turn Off Water: Before performing any maintenance, ensure the water supply to the sprinkler is turned off.
  2. Remove Sprinkler Head: Unscrew the sprinkler head from the riser.
  3. Access Filter: The filter screen is located at the base of the sprinkler head inlet. Gently pull it out.
  4. Clean Filter: Rinse the filter screen under running water to remove any debris, dirt, or sediment. A soft brush can be used for stubborn particles.
  5. Reinstall: Insert the clean filter back into the sprinkler head inlet, then reattach the sprinkler head to the riser.
  6. Test: Turn on the water supply and check for proper operation.

Winterization:

In regions with freezing temperatures, it is recommended to drain your irrigation system and remove sprinkler heads to prevent damage from freezing water. Consult your irrigation system's manual for specific winterization procedures.

7. Troubleshooting

Refer to the following table for common issues and their solutions:

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Reduced spray distance or irregular patternClogged filter or nozzleClean the filter screen (see Maintenance section). Check the nozzle for debris and clear if necessary.
Water leaking from connection pointLoose connection or damaged threadsEnsure the sprinkler head is securely hand-tightened onto the riser. Inspect threads for damage; replace if necessary.
No water sprayWater supply off or completely cloggedVerify the water supply to the irrigation system is on. Check for severe clogs in the nozzle or filter.
